## TKT-4182: Config drift on Vigilqueue workers

Proctoring queue workers in pod C are running stale settings — visibility timeout and retry count differ from the declared state. Likely cause: manual hotfix two weeks ago never committed. Impact: duplicate session flags. Re-apply declared config and restart workers. The expected values are below.

settings of bafof-fajog:
[aldix]
port = 9300
region = north-3
host = aldix.kelvilabs.example
team = istath
timeout_ms = 1500
retries = 8

## Turnstile Counter Recovery — Halverd Arena

If gate counts freeze, restart the `gatecountd` service on the concourse node first. Do not reset the hardware encoder; it desyncs lane totals until midnight rollover. Verify counts against the Stilefeed dashboard within five minutes of restart. If drift exceeds 2%, flush the local buffer and replay from the Stilefeed event log. Replays require authenticated access to the internal Stilefeed ingest API. Use the key below when prompted by the replay tool.

app token of bahaf-tajeg = zpat23_SjjsllwiLmXbtS65veZaV47

Handover Note – Reseller Programme

Tarn, here's the state of play on the Lumenreach reseller programme as I step across to Operations. Forty-two active partners, tiered margins running 18–26%, and the Q3 incentive pool is fully committed. The Halverston channel review lands next month — worth attending. Rebate accruals are current through last week. One piece of context before you dig in.

confidential, kagup-bafog: Fraaxax Group is in early talks to buy Soroxox Group for about $343.8 million. The Olidor launch date is June 14, and nothing goes to the press before then. Legal wants the Aldmirek Logistics term sheet signed before July 23.